Abstract
The complex [1-(4′-fluorobenzyl)pyridinium]2[Ni(dto) 2] (dto2- means clithiooxalate dianion) has been prepared by reaction of Na2[Ni(S2C2O2) 2] and the 1-(4′-fluorobenzyl) pyridinium chloride salt. The crystallographic data for the title complex: triclinic P1, a = 8.5698(8) Å, b =9.3461(9) Å, c = 10.5361(10) Å, α = 67.177 (2)°, β = 67.398(2)°, γ = 79.611(2)°, V = 717.59(12) Å3, Z = 1. The [Ni(dto)2]2- anion with the Ni atom lying on an inversion center and exhibits a quasi-planar structure. An extensive hydrogen bond network of C - H⋯ O is clearly observed. The nature and size of cation seems to play an important factor in the type of intermolecular interactions as well as the crystal packing in this kind of complexes.
